
Following in her father’s footsteps, Kanye West and Kim Kardashian’s eldest daughter North announced she plans to release her debut album, with a title inspired by her dad’s own debut project.

Standing center stage by her father’s side at the Vultures 2 listening party in Phoenix, AZ on Sunday, March 10, North made the announcement. “I’ve been working on an album and it is called Elementary School Dropout,” the 10-year-old said, receiving a roaring response from the crowd.
If you’re here, you most likely already know that Ye dropped his seminal debut album The College Dropout in 2004. And now, 20 years later, his daughter plans to do the same.
The reveal comes of the heals of North making her official musical debut on the track “Talking” off her father and Ty Dolla $igns first of three collab albums, Vultures 1.
On the song, North raps, “I love it here / We’re gonna take over another year / It’s your bestie, Miss, Miss Westie / Don’t try to test me / It’s gonna get messy / Just, just bless me, bless me/ It’s your bestie, Miss, Miss Westie.”
